Jan Marx
 
7095 votes
25.51%
- Occupation: Businesswoman/Attorney/Mediator
 - Former City Council and Planning Commission Member
 - Former County Parks and Recreation Commissioner
 - Land Use and Estate Planning Attorney and Mediator with her own firm
 - Former Deputy District Attorney and co-founder of the Temporary Restraining Order Clinic
 - BA Stanford, MA Columbia University, JD University of Santa Clara
 - Businesswoman and member SLO Chamber since 1993, SLO Rotary, SLO Bicycle Coalition
  
Priorities:
- Preserve unique natural, historical and financial resources through implementing "Smart Growth" principles.
 - Encourage economic growth and a strong downtown while bringing back fiscal responsibility
 - Update General Plan Land Use and Circulation Elements by consulting with residents to plan a healthy community
  
 
John B. Ashbaugh
 
6402 votes
23.02%
- Occupation: Educator
 - City of SLO Planning Commission, Vice-Chair (4 yrs)
 - College and Secondary HistoryTeacher (8 yrs)
 - Planning Consultant/Business Owner (22 yrs)
 - SLO County Land Conservancy, Founding Director
 - Leadership in many local service organizations
 - Member, American Federation of Teachers
  
Priorities:
- Committed to fiscal reponsibility for the City of San Luis Obispo
 - Maintain acceptable growth - update the general plan, protect open space and farmlands
 - Retain SLO as "Center of the Central Coast" - Retain SLO Airport, expand cultural amenities
  
Paul Brown
 
5943 votes
21.37%
- Occupation: Councilman/Restaurant Owner
 - Owner/Founder - Award winning Downtown San Luis Obispo restaurant  - Mother's Tavern
 - Board of Directors - San Luis Obispo Chamber of Commerce
 - Board of Directors - EOC
 - Vice-Commander - American Legion / Post 66
 - ARMY Military Police Sergeant
 - B.S. Agriculture Education - Cal Poly  '92
  
Priorities:
- Maintaining the quality of life we appreciate in San Luis Obispo by investing in police and fire protection, our parks , and our streets and sidewalks
 - Providing opportunities for workforce families to continue living in our city
 - Preserving San Luis Obipo's position as the business, cultural, social, and entertainment center of the county
  
Dan Carpenter
 
5568 votes
20.02%
- Occupation: SLO Planning Commissioner
 - B.S. Business Managment-Cal Poly '76
 - Cultural Heritage Committee / City of SLO
 - SLO County Historical Society / Board of Directors
 - Business Owner Downtown SLO / 20 Years
 - Cal Poly Bookstore Manager / Retired
  
Priorities:
- Promoting and protecting the quality of life that each of us have come to enjoy with emphasis on neighborhood and historical resource preservation
 - Attracting and maintaining quality head of household  jobs and adequate housing opportunities for the community
 - Promoting business investment and protecting the fiscal integrity of our community with sound management practices
